Sayama (狭山市, Sayama-shi), formerly known as Irumagawa, is a city located in Saitama Prefecture, Japan. Sayama translates as "sitting on a mountain”. The city was founded on July 1, 1954. of October 1, 2010, the city has an estimated population of 15..
